Mechanism of Action

Both Cenforce 200 and Viagra work by inhibiting the enzyme phosphodiesterase type 5 (PDE5). This action increases the levels of cyclic GMP, a substance that helps relax the smooth muscles in the blood vessels of the penis.

As a result, there is enhanced blood flow, leading to an erection when sexually stimulated. While their mechanisms are identical, the difference lies in the dosage and formulation, which can affect their efficacy and side effect profiles.

Side Effects and Safety

Both Cenforce 200 and Viagra share similar side effects due to their common active ingredient. Common side effects include headaches, flushing, nasal congestion, and digestive issues. However, the risk of side effects can be more pronounced with higher doses like Cenforce 200. Users should be cautious and start with lower doses if they experience adverse effects.

Cenforce 200's higher potency can also increase the risk of experiencing side effects, especially if taken without medical supervision. Viagra, being available in lower doses, might offer a better starting point for those new to ED medications.

Drug Interactions and Precautions

Both medications can interact with other drugs, especially nitrates and alpha-blockers, which can lead to serious side effects such as a dangerous drop in blood pressure. It's crucial to inform your healthcare provider of all medications you are taking to avoid potential interactions.

Cenforce 200 and Viagra both require precautions for individuals with certain medical conditions, including heart disease and liver impairment. Following your healthcare provider's guidance on usage and dosage is essential to minimize risks and ensure safe use.
